Chukars Dealt 3-1 Loss
|
Lethbridge pitcher Tristram Thiele had a large part in his team beating the Idaho Falls Chukars, 3-1. The right-hander kept opposing batters in check throughout the game. Thiele got the win, improving to 2-3. He gave up 5 hits and walked 2 over 6.1 innings. He allowed 1 run. Mancelo Jarquin, summoned from the bullpen, notched his 2nd save.
Lethbridge used a clutch at-bat from Israel Talavera to capture the win. The designated hitter hammered a 3-run home run in the top of the sixth inning to put the Black Diamonds ahead, 3-0. It was his lone hit in 4 at-bats, but it was a humdinger.
"Tough loss," said Idaho Falls manager Owen Lanier. "But we'll learn from it."
Lethbridge is third in the Pioneer League North Division with a record of 16-13.
